Transaction 76ae4cb6eb00c79125f77bfb375603e2022d4bb06ea2e38d599a812558475c3c
1 Input
1 Output
-
76ae4cb6eb00c79125f77bfb375603e2022d4bb06ea2e38d599a812558475c3c:0
- value
- 2656440
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 186aba7f35a4f0d5b47ed379161ca29e60833aeae3bac394a79deb0cdf8ece9b
- address
- bc1prp4t5le45ncdtdr76du3v89znesgxwh2uwav8998nh4sehuwe6dsv47xyn